Understanding Kiwi Fruit Nutrition and Health Benefits

Kiwi fruit stands out as one of nature's most nutrient-dense foods, offering an impressive array of vitamins, minerals, and phytonutrients in a relatively small package. A single medium kiwi fruit contains approximately 61 calories and provides substantial nutritional value that can support various aspects of human health. According to nutritional research, kiwis contain vitamin C levels that rival citrus fruits—one kiwi delivers about 64 mg of vitamin C, representing roughly 107% of the daily recommended intake for adults.

Beyond vitamin C, kiwi fruits contain significant amounts of vitamin K, an essential nutrient for bone health and blood clotting mechanisms. The fruit also provides vitamin E, a powerful antioxidant that helps protect cells from oxidative damage. Research published in nutrition journals indicates that kiwis contain actinidin, a proteolytic enzyme that can help break down proteins, potentially aiding in digestive processes. The fruit's fiber content—approximately 2.1 grams per medium fruit—supports healthy digestive function and can help maintain steady blood sugar levels.

The polyphenol compounds found in kiwi fruit have attracted significant scientific attention. These plant compounds possess antioxidant and anti-inflammatory properties that many people find beneficial. Studies examining kiwi consumption have noted effects on inflammatory markers and oxidative stress indicators. The combination of natural sugars, fiber, and micronutrients makes kiwis an interesting addition to various dietary approaches.

Digestive Health and Kiwi Fruit Consumption

The digestive benefits associated with kiwi fruit consumption have been the subject of multiple clinical investigations. Research examining the effects of kiwi on gastrointestinal function reveals interesting findings relevant to digestive health management. One notable study published in medical literature involved participants consuming kiwi fruit regularly, with researchers observing improvements in bowel movement frequency and consistency compared to control groups. The actinidin enzyme present in green kiwis appears to support the breakdown of dietary proteins, potentially reducing digestive discomfort for some individuals.

The fiber composition in kiwi fruit differs notably from many other fruits. While soluble fiber helps nurture beneficial gut bacteria and can contribute to feelings of fullness, the insoluble fiber supports regular bowel movements. Epidemiological data suggests that populations consuming adequate fiber intake—which kiwis can help provide—experience lower rates of gastrointestinal disorders. Some people consuming kiwis report experiencing improved regularity within days, though individual responses vary considerably.

Many healthcare practitioners recommend kiwi fruit as part of dietary approaches to support digestive wellness. The fruit's natural composition makes it compatible with various dietary patterns and restrictive diets. For individuals seeking to enhance their digestive function through food-based solutions, kiwis offer a palatable and practical option. The presence of natural prebiotics in kiwis may help support the growth of beneficial bacteria in the colon, creating an environment conducive to optimal digestive processes.

Cardiovascular Health and Heart Function Support

Scientific investigation into kiwi fruit's relationship with cardiovascular health has produced compelling evidence. The fruit contains multiple compounds that many researchers believe contribute to heart health promotion. Potassium, abundant in kiwis at approximately 312 mg per medium fruit, plays a crucial role in blood pressure regulation by counteracting sodium's effects and supporting healthy vascular function. Population studies examining dietary potassium intake consistently demonstrate associations between adequate potassium consumption and lower blood pressure readings.

The polyphenol content in kiwi fruit has demonstrated effects on several cardiovascular markers in clinical settings. Research participants consuming kiwis showed measurable improvements in triglyceride levels, a significant risk factor for cardiovascular disease. One particular study followed individuals with elevated triglycerides who consumed two to three kiwis daily, revealing reductions in triglyceride concentrations and improvements in overall lipid profiles. The vitamin E content, functioning as a lipophilic antioxidant, helps protect lipids from oxidation—a process implicated in atherosclerosis development.

Platelet aggregation, the process by which blood cells clump together, represents another area where kiwi consumption shows promise. Excessive platelet aggregation contributes to thrombotic events and cardiovascular complications. Research indicates that kiwi consumption can help maintain platelet function within normal ranges, potentially reducing clotting risk. The combination of these various mechanisms—potassium effects on blood pressure, polyphenol antioxidant activity, and impacts on platelet function—positions kiwis as a valuable addition to heart-conscious dietary approaches.

Sleep Quality and Serotonin Support Through Kiwi Consumption

Recent scientific investigations have illuminated fascinating connections between kiwi fruit consumption and sleep quality improvement. Several human studies specifically examining kiwis and sleep parameters have documented notable findings. In one randomized controlled trial, participants consuming two kiwis one hour before bedtime showed significant improvements in sleep onset time, sleep duration, and overall sleep efficiency compared to control groups. The average time to fall asleep decreased by approximately 35%, while total sleep duration increased by roughly 13% in kiwi-consuming groups.

The neurochemical mechanisms behind these effects involve serotonin and melatonin pathways. Kiwis contain compounds that may influence serotonin production and availability in the brain. Serotonin serves not only as a mood regulator but also as a precursor to melatonin, the hormone directly responsible for sleep-wake cycle regulation. The presence of folate, magnesium, and antioxidants in kiwis supports these neurochemical processes. Magnesium, in particular, acts as a natural relaxation agent, helping to calm neural activity and prepare the body for sleep. Some sleep researchers recommend kiwis specifically because they provide these compounds in a whole-food matrix that the body can easily process and utilize.

Many individuals seeking natural approaches to sleep improvement have incorporated kiwis into evening routines with reportedly positive results. The fruit's natural sweetness satisfies cravings without the stimulating effects of caffeine or the weight of heavy foods. For individuals struggling with insomnia or irregular sleep patterns, kiwis represent a evidence-based, food-based intervention worth exploring.
